How Termites and WDO Threaten Florida Homes
Florida’s warm, humid climate creates the perfect environment for termites and other wood‑destroying organisms (WDO). These pests can cause major structural damage long before homeowners notice the signs. A professional WDO inspection helps protect your home from costly repairs and hidden infestations. Understanding Insurance Inspections in Florida: What Homeowners Need to Know
Florida’s insurance requirements can feel overwhelming, especially for homeowners navigating wind, storms, and rising premiums. Insurance inspections help determine a home’s risk level — and they play a major role in how much you pay each year. 4‑Point Inspections Most insurance companies require a 4‑point inspection for older homes.
